About this map

Staten Island's western and southern shorelines are captured in detail here during a period of significant suburban expansion and industrial activity along the Arthur Kill. The landscape is a complex mix of dense residential clusters like Eltingville and Annadale, and large institutional grounds including the Willowbrook State School, Sea View Hospital, and the Farm Colony. The industrial corridors of Linden and Carteret on the New Jersey side contrast with the tidal wetlands of Fresh Kills and the Island of Meadows.
